Minor Injury Sustained in Late-Afternoon Collision on Maple Street
The Daily News Online
Summary of “One transported with minor injury after accident in Batavia”
On a late‑afternoon evening in Batavia, a small but serious traffic collision left a resident with a minor injury that required transport to a local medical facility. The incident, reported by The Daily News Online and covered in its accompanying news story, unfolded on a main thoroughfare in the town and prompted an immediate response from emergency services, the police department, and medical staff.
The Incident
The accident occurred on March 12, 2023 around 5:32 p.m. at the intersection of Maple Street and 23rd Avenue. A white 2019 Chevrolet Silverado, driven by a local resident, collided with a blue 2020 Honda Civic. According to the initial police dispatch report, the Silverado was traveling northbound on Maple Street and failed to yield to the Honda, which was turning right into the intersection. The collision forced the Civic into a nearby sidewalk, but fortunately the occupant was not injured to a serious degree.
The casualty was a 27‑year‑old male who was the driver of the Honda. He was promptly assessed by paramedics on scene and found to have a sprained ankle and a minor cut on his right wrist. No broken bones or head injuries were reported. While the injuries were classified as “minor,” the decision was made to transport the individual to St. Mary’s Hospital on Main Street for a full evaluation and to ensure no complications arose.
Response and Investigation
The Batavia Police Department, which responded to the scene within minutes, immediately began an investigation. Officers noted that the Silverado’s tires appeared to have lost traction on the wet asphalt, a factor that contributed to the collision. Witness statements were collected from two on‑lookers who confirmed the sequence of events: the Civic turned right, the Silverado failed to stop, and the impact caused the Civic to jack‑knife into the sidewalk.
A crucial part of the investigation was the examination of the vehicle’s black‑box data. The Silverado’s data log showed a sudden deceleration at 0.6 g, indicating a hard braking effort just before the impact. The Civic’s log recorded no abnormal braking or speed. No signs of alcohol or drug impairment were found in either vehicle’s telemetry, nor did the police discover any suspicious substances at the scene.
Despite the lack of obvious negligence, the Silverv’s driver was issued a traffic citation for failure to yield. The citation was served by the Batavia Police Department’s Deputy Chief, who emphasized the importance of staying attentive at intersections, especially during evening traffic.
Medical Care
St. Mary’s Hospital, a regional medical center that often treats traffic‑related injuries, was alerted by the ambulance crew. The patient was taken to the emergency department, where a X‑ray ruled out any fractures. A minor laceration on the wrist was cleaned, dressed, and the patient was given a prescription for pain relief. After a brief observation period, the patient was released with instructions to rest the ankle and to return for a follow‑up appointment in 48 hours. The hospital staff assured that the injuries were unlikely to impede the individual’s day‑to‑day activities.
Community Reaction
The local community, via a comment section on the Daily News Online article, expressed relief that the injuries were minor. Many readers took the opportunity to share their own traffic safety tips, such as keeping a safe distance, checking for pedestrians on side streets, and following speed limits. One commenter noted that this was the third traffic accident at the Maple Street/23rd Avenue intersection in the past two months, urging local authorities to examine the intersection’s design and signage.
